Output 5cf3f62565ed7f4142d07527ca07204f97e1b0d41dd4ffc8dcd9de090af196e0:2

value
130000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bffbca2d27ca4c7440647018e1a8d646284b934 OP_EQUAL
address
3MkGGTpCERd7eiN2ZE5FrcWHyHMjje9e5z
transaction
5cf3f62565ed7f4142d07527ca07204f97e1b0d41dd4ffc8dcd9de090af196e0
confirmations
383977
spent
true